Flipperachi Set to Rock Mumbai

Flipperachi to perform in Mumbai


Rapper Flipperachi, known for his hit 'Dhurandhar', is gearing up for a concert in Mumbai on March 13. Expressing his enthusiasm, he shared, “The love I’ve received from India has been overwhelming, and performing in Mumbai has always been a dream of mine. The vibrant energy, the people, and the culture resonate with me. This concert promises to be loud, emotional, and unforgettable. Mumbai, prepare yourselves!”


Stranger Things Broadway Play to Stream on Netflix

Stranger Things Broadway play to stream soon


The acclaimed Broadway play 'Stranger Things: The First Shadow' is set to stream on Netflix. This filming brings the theatrical experience of the 'Stranger Things' universe to viewers at home, featuring the original Broadway cast in their current roles. Regular performances will resume on February 15, with Tony nominee Louis McCartney leading the cast as Henry Creel, a role he originated in London's West End.


Jaafar Jackson Discusses His Role as Michael Jackson

Jaafar ‘had to really earn' role of Michael Jackson


Jaafar Jackson has shared insights into his portrayal of his legendary uncle, Michael Jackson, in the upcoming biopic titled 'Michael'. He revealed that he had to 'really earn the role'. A sneak peek behind the scenes was released on February 10, showcasing Jaafar's transformation into the King of Pop. “I never imagined becoming an actor or playing him, but I felt it was a calling,” Jaafar, 29, expressed in the video.


Britney Spears Sells Music Rights

Britney sells rights to music catalogue


Pop sensation Britney Spears has finalized a deal to sell her music rights to the independent publisher Primary Wave, marking her as the latest artist to make such a move. The singer, known for hits like 'Oops!... I Did It Again' and 'Toxic', signed the agreement on December 30.
